Monday Injury Update: Dawgs A Little Healthier Headed To Tuscaloosa

September 24, 2024 by Dawg Sports

Tennessee Tech v Georgia
Photo by Todd Kirkland/Getty Images

George is headed to Tuscaloosa to face the most physical, deep football team. The Bulldogs have seen this season. It sounds like Kirby Smart team may do so with some of the key parts back that they were missing against the Kentucky Wildcats.

The most pressing injury news of course surrounds linebacker Mykel Williams, who’s been out since the Clemson opener. Today Kirby said that he is “hopeful” that William will be back after another good week of rehab, but conceded that he has not practiced to this point.

Warren Brinson missed the Kentucky game after suffering an ankle injury against Tennessee Tech. However, it sounds like he practiced at the tail end of the week and should probably be expected in the lineup against the Crimson Tide.

Brinson’s line mate Jordan Hall continues to rehab his injury, but coach likewise sounded fairly confident that he’ll see the field this weekend as well.

Xzavier McLeod returned from injury for the Kentucky game, getting two assisted tackles and getting in on a tackle for loss in his first action of the season. Having a full complement of defensive linemen healthy won’t be sufficient to secure victory over the Tide. But it’s probably a necessary precondition.

Offensively the Red and Black will be without starting guard Tate Ratledge, who’s recovering from TightRope surgery on a high ankle sprain and a sprained knee that didn’t require surgical intervention. Micah Morris moved into Ratledge’s spot during the Kentucky game and will likely man that spot Saturday. But Coach Searels also has the option of sliding Dylan Fairchild over from left guard.

Carson Beck reportedly suffered an AC joint sprain of his non-throwing shoulder, but Beck and Coach Smart have both said Beck is fine and hasn’t missed any practice. If anything, I’d be a little concerned about whether the injury will keep Beck from taking off on the ground and using his legs on Saturday, as well as whether he’s affected if he takes hits from that attacking Kane Wommack defense.

Roderick Robinson remains out following toe surgery and is unlikely to play against the Tide.

Georgia will provide an additional update on its injury situation on Wednesday night when it releases its official league-mandated availability report through the SEC. The availability report will then be published daily, with a final report released 90 minutes prior to kickoff Saturday evening. Until later….
